Redington Things To Do
Beaches
At first glance it’s easy to mistake the beautiful white sand beaches at Redington Beach for those found in the Caribbean or the Maldives. Florida’s west coast is home to some of its most stunning award winning beaches. The warm turquoise waters of the Gulf of Mexico are perfect for swimming, snorkelling, and diving. With 28 miles of pristine beaches stretched along the coastline it will not be hard to find a secluded spot on which to stretch out and relax in the hot Florida sunshine.
Water Sports
As you would expect from a location with an all year round hot climate and miles of beaches there is no shortage of water sports in Redington beach. Windsurfing, diving, sailing, snorkelling and even swimming with dolphins are a big part of the daily life in Redington Beach. Cruises and boat trips along the coastline are the perfect way to spend sunny days and warm evenings.
Sightseeing
The vibrant cosmopolitan city of Tampa and the theme parks of Disney World and Universal Studios are just a few of the many sightseeing trips to be taken from Redington Beach. Orlando is only 90 minutes from Redington Beach and the thrilling theme parks are the perfect alternative to the relaxing beach life. The amazing Busch Gardens is a mere 30 minutes from Redington Beach and an entire day can be spent enjoying the rollercoaster’s and Sea World shows at this popular theme park.
Golf
Golf lovers will be in heaven on a holiday in Redington Beach and nearby North Redington Beach. With over 34 first class golf courses to choose from, many boasting spectacular views over the Gulf Coast and with an excellent climate this is the place for a round of golf at any time of the day. Children can also enjoy the many mini golf courses in the area.
